26 May 2022 - Global pension, insurer, asset and wealth managers network the Investment Leaders Group (ILG) has announced Rick Lacaille, Executive Vice President and Global Head of ESG for State Street as its new chair. 

Rick’s deep knowledge and perspective will support the ILG to broaden its focus beyond the measurement of sustainable investment impacts, and drive change in the real economy to support the transition to a low carbon, nature positive and societally resilient world. 

The Investment Leaders Group is convened by the University of Cambridge Institute for Sustainability Leadership (CISL) and collaborates to deliver real world research insights that investors need and can use to unlock sustainable investment challenges.

Rick’s career spans 12 years as CIO of State Street Global Advisors, the world’s fourth largest asset manager, and through his current role he offers valuable insights on mobilising capital to scale sustainable investment outcomes. His detailed engagement with the market and groups including the Sustainable Markets Initiative brings opportunities for powerful collaborations and will prove useful for the ILG’s next three-year focus on fostering consensus on sustainable investment challenges and opportunities.

Outgoing Chair, John Belgrove, previously Senior Partner and Director of Forward Thinking, Aon has overseen a number of significant achievements during his three-year chairmanship including: 

  • Development of work on nature-related financial risks, culminating in CISL being named an official knowledge partner of the Taskforce for Nature-related Financial Disclosures (TNFD); 

  • Co-creating a series of use cases that demonstrate how asset managers can start assessing nature-related financial risks in their portfolios. 

The ILG has also built on previous work on the climate performance of investment funds and broadened its focus to social impacts, supporting investors to promote and measure decent work to facilitate a just transition. Moving into its fourth three-year phase since its founding, the ILG will turn its attention to how investment in nature and more equal societies at scale can enhance asset resilience and help to secure a sustainable future for all.
